Solar Insights - ☀️ Can rooftop solar really save money? New Plymouth Council says yes

As more homeowners explore ways to reduce their electricity bills, real-life examples can provide valuable insight.

New Plymouth District Council has reported that its recent investment in rooftop solar is already delivering savings. Two new solar installations are expected to pay for themselves within around six years while helping reduce ongoing electricity costs and lowering carbon emissions. The council says the systems are already generating thousands of dollars in savings and supplying a significant share of each building’s electricity needs.
